Transaction bc8effe16b305a719202ef596ddb5a5666842c2652216e401d4030db5d4f9146
1 Input
1 Output
-
bc8effe16b305a719202ef596ddb5a5666842c2652216e401d4030db5d4f9146:0
- value
- 624136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d05073cdda61e7533e670683ac86168547badd3 OP_EQUAL
- address
- 38iFyghF8hKMntA5VkrCRZcvv4rvQoVqPS